Missing words
My thirst it has been slaked my hunger has been sated today I feasted on your words drank all that you created A drought it was that I had suffered these past few lonely days I had lived among the starving missing your poetic ways But today the rains came once again and what a crop they brought I hope it rains again tomorrow so others see what I have sought
